Vancomycin impairs macrophage fungal killing by disrupting mitochondrial morphology and function

Ebrima Bojang,
Lozan Sheriff,
Man Shun Fu
et al.

Abstract: Vancomycin is a widely prescribed antibiotic used in the treatment of Gram-positive bacterial infections. We recently showed that this antibiotic disrupted protective anti-fungal immune responses via microbiome dysbiosis, enhancing susceptibility to invasive candidiasis. Antibiotics are an independent risk factor for developing this life-threatening fungal infection, but whether microbiota-independent mechanisms also drive this association is not clear.
